What is the difference between A Studio Engineer vs A Sound Engineer?

AspectA Studio EngineerA Sound Engineer
CredentialsTypically a degree in audio engineering or related fieldOften similar credentials, including degrees or certifications in audio or sound engineering
Work EnvironmentRecording studios, post-production facilities, music studiosLive events, broadcasting, recording studios
Industry UsagePrimarily in music, film, and media productionBroadcasting, live sound, music production

Both roles require similar educational backgrounds and often overlap in skills. A Studio Engineer mainly focuses on recording, mixing, and producing audio in studio settings, while a Sound Engineer may work in live environments or broadcasting. The key difference lies in their typical work environments and specific job functions, but both are essential in audio production industries.

What does a studio engineer do?

A studio engineer is responsible for setting up, operating, and maintaining audio recording equipment in a recording studio. They manage sound quality, troubleshoot technical issues, and collaborate with artists and producers to achieve desired audio results, often using tools like mixing consoles and digital audio workstations.
